Microsoft: Teens don't understand intellectual property
Microsoft has also released the findings of a survey stating that 49% of teens between 7th and 10th grade don't know "the rules and guidelines" for downloading media from the internet. But 82% of teens who said they were familiar with those rules said that people who downloaded content illegally should be punished. That's compared with 57% from teenagers who were unfamiliar with the law.
